WAU - 6 Jun 2012

Schools for Abyei IDPs near Wau lack proper buildings

Refugees from Abyei living in Western Bahr El Ghazal lack proper schools for their children.

An educator at Bar Yar School, which is located in a camp occupied by people displaced from Abyei, said that the school is facing many problems. Most of the teachers are teaching on voluntary basis, he said.

‘The government did not support us to remove these problems’, said Yai Madut to Radio Tamazuj.

He pointed out that the school’s 6 classrooms are insufficient to hold the school’s 568 students.

Yai called for urgent supply of building materials to provide a conducive school environment to the children.
